State Of Origin Game 2 Tips, Teams and Odds – QLD Maroons vs NSW Blues

We take a look at Game 2 of the 2019 State Of Origin Series on Sunday night (23/6/2019) in Perth at Optus Stadium. Queensland took out Game 1 in Brisbane and will be out to seal up the series although the NSW Blues are going to be very hard to beat.

When: Sunday 23rd June at 7:50PM

Where: Optus Stadium in Perth

Teams:

NEW SOUTH WALES BLUES: 1. James Tedesco 2. Blake Ferguson 3. Tom Trbojevic 4. Jack Wighton 5. Josh Addo-Carr 6. James Maloney 7. Nathan Cleary 8. Daniel Saifiti 9. Damien Cook 10. Paul Vaughan 11. Boyd Cordner (c) 12. Tyson Frizell 13. Jake Trbojevic. Interchange: 14. Dale Finucane 15. Tariq Sims 16. Cameron Murray 17. Wade Graham.

QUEENSLAND MAROONS: 1. Kalyn Ponga 2. Corey Oates 3. Michael Morgan 4. Will Chambers 5. Dane Gagai 6. Cameron Munster 7. Daly Cherry-Evans (c) 8. Dylan Napa 9. Ben Hunt 10. Josh Papalii 11. Felise Kaufusi 12. Matt Gillett 13. Josh McGuire. Interchange: 14. Moses Mbye 15. Jarrod Wallace 16. Tim Glasby 17. David Fifita.
